abstract = "The lakes and reservoirs morphometry as surface shape, surface
area, underwater form, depth, and the irregularity of their
shoreline have a major impact on turbulence, water stratification,
sedimentation and resuspension, and the extent of littoral-zone
wetlands that determine lake and reservoir functioning. The degree
of irregularity is most frequently estimated from the shoreline
development factor that reflects the extent to which the measured
shore length is greater than the length of the circumference of a
circle of an area equal to that of the lake. As indicated by
Assireu et al. (2004), this index is not able to detect
high-resolution geomorphologic features. In this work we present a
dynamical morphometric index, based on recognition pattern
techniques, which enable us to identify, for each wind direction,
what are the reservoir regions not subject to wind-induced
turbulence.",
